    Watson had some really impressive moments last night throwing the ball.

    His pre snap ability is getting really good.

    Last night, prior to converting on a third down to Keke.

    He saw the blitz coming off the edge and yelled at his rookie receiver to run a hot route against a LB in coverage.

    Keke broke off his route for the first down. Super impressive pre snap.

    That's because the Texans have moved away from the passing game. BOB is afraid Watson will throw interceptions or get hurt so he's keeping his pass attempts down in order to run the ball more and shorten the games. He's playing to win with the defense. Personally I think that's just bad coaching because I believe Watson is capable of a lot more, but they've won 8 in a row so it makes it more difficult to criticize what he's doing since it happens to be working.....and like the saying goes, if it's stupid, but it works, it ain't stupid.

    With the fewer pass attempts he won't put up the gaudy TD numbers he did last season while healthy, but his QB rating sits just outside the top 10 and he's still thrown for more TD's this year than Tom Brady, so that's not bad.
